Laurens De Bock is a 33-year-old football player who plays as a center back, born on November 7, 1992, who is left-footed. Follow Laurens De Bock on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.
In the 2023/2024 Super League Relegation Group season, Laurens De Bock has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 360 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.62, 1 yellow card.

Laurens De Bock's career has also included time at Atromitos, Zulte Waregem, Leeds United, ADO Den Haag, Sunderland, Oostende, Club Brugge, and Lokeren.
On the international stage, Laurens De Bock has represented Belgium, Belgium U21, and Belgium U19.

Throughout their career, Laurens De Bock has won 4 titles: Cup (2014/2015), First Division A (2015/2016), and Super Cup (2016/2017) with Club Brugge and Cup (2011/2012) with Lokeren.
Laurens De Bock has competed in Super League, First Division A, League One, Eredivisie, FA Cup, Championship, Champions League Qualification qualification, Champions League, and Europa League.
